Audit Analysis

The Chattanooga (St. Elmo Preservation) urban forest carbon project is a tree preservation initiative under the CFC standard with a 40-year crediting period. Additionality was confirmed by an independent VVB via a combined test, and a 10% buffer pool is in place, but the project-specific baseline, unaddressed reversal risk over four decades, and several missing MRV details (FNRB, usage monitoring) limit confidence. No contradictions were found and the verified ERR matches the claimed figure exactly for the monitoring period.

Red Flags

  • Reversal events are listed as 'not addressed' despite a 40-year permanence claim (2020–2060), leaving the buffer pool's adequacy untested against actual risk
  • Leakage is described as 'quantified' in the justification but no specific deduction percentage is stated in any available document
  • Baseline is project-specific with no reassessment date recorded, and the CFC standard's reassessment cadence is not confirmed in the extracted record
